161011-N-AC117-214 EAST CHINA SEA (Oct. 10, 2016) Cmdr. Gregory Malandrino, commanding officer of the “Diamondbacks” of Strike Fighter Squadron (VFA) 102, cuts a cake with Cmdr. Barrett Smith, executive officer of VFA-102, aboard the Navy's only forward-deployed aircraft carrier, USS Ronald Reagan (CVN 76) following the VFA-102 change-of-command ceremony. During the ceremony, Malandrino relieved Cmdr. Rafe Wysham as commanding officer. Ronald Reagan, the Carrier Strike Group Five (CSG 5) flagship, is on patrol supporting security and stability in the Indo-Asia-Pacific region. (U.S. Navy photo by Seaman MacAdam Kane Weissman/Released)
